    Ludwig van Beethoven
    Symphony No.6 in F Major, Op.68 'Pastoral'
    Wilhelm Furtwängler, Berliner Philharmoniker
    Recorded live at Titania Palast, 25-V-1947
    0:00 I. Erwachen heiterer Empfindungen bei der Ankunft auf dem Lande (allegro)
    11:03 II. Szene am Bach (andante molto mosso)
    24:03 III. Lustiges Zusammensein der Landleute (allegro)
    29:36 IV. Gewitter. Sturm (allegro)
    33:40 V. Hirtengesang. Frohe und dankbare Gefühle nach dem Sturm (allegretto)

    Listeners should know that this performance was part of the legendary concert (first one after WWII and denazification of Furt..) which has historical significance and also included Symphony 5. Reports at the time stated that at the end of the concert, both the orchestra and the audiences were in tears (of joy I suppose).
